Just eight months after launch and the highly innovative, wheelchair Expedition Dazcat 52 is living the good life in the Caribbean. Dazcat Media catches up with owner Tom via zoom to find out how they're getting on. Having done his sailing theory online during lockdown and otherwise armed with only very limited practical sailing experience, Tom, Artemis and her crew have learnt the ropes together. First a season in Scotland followed by a quick stop back at the yard. Then it was down to Gibraltar to soak up some autumn sun before crossing. EDIT: Correction - Tom tells me he completed both theory and practicals pre-lockdown. Sorry for the mistake Tom. It was good to 'meet up' with Tom and we chat about the crossing, future plans and the challenges posed by the pandemic, teething troubles and support from Multimarine, maintaining communication while cruising, wildlife...Tom's message is clear - if you can untie the lines and go, then do it! Artemis is a custom build by Multimarine, based at the @Multihull Centre in Cornwall, UK.
